Robert Nemecek Wikipedia And Bio: Who Is He?
Robert Nemecek, a seasoned media professional and freelance media consultant, boasts over 13 years of extensive experience in the field. His journey in the television industry has seen him excel in various key roles, demonstrating both expertise and leadership.
Notably, Nemecek served as the Editor-In-Chief at TV Avala from February to December 2010 and played a pivotal role as the Assistant Managing Director at RTS Broadcasting Corporation of Serbia from April 2004 to April 2007.
Throughout his decades-long career, Nemecek has left an indelible mark on the programming landscape. He briefly served as the Programming Director at TV B92 in 2004 before becoming the Programming Director at Belgrade TV. However, his most substantial contribution came during his over eight-year tenure as the Programming Director at TV Pink, from September 1994 to February 2003. At TV Pink, Nemecek not only steered the programming direction but also created and implemented innovative strategies that influenced the politics of current trends in foreign programs.
Beyond the realms of television, Nemecek’s educational background includes graduating from the Musical High School Stankovic in 1970, specializing in Music Theory and Composition. In addition to his professional pursuits, he has showcased his multifaceted talents by being a founding member of several pop-rock bands, including Pop Mašina, adding a musical dimension to his rich involvement in the worlds of media and music.

Robert Nemecek Family Explored
Robert Nemecek’s family heritage is intricately woven into the cultural fabric of Serbia, beginning with his great-grandfather, a talented violinist who journeyed from Czechia to join the royal orchestra in Serbia.
This musical legacy continued through subsequent generations, with Nemecek’s grandfather, Josip, and father, Jan, the latter of whom played a pivotal role in establishing the Belgrade Philharmonic. The family’s influence extended to Ludvig, Nemecek’s uncle, who pursued jazz trumpet, and Ludmila, his aunt, a dedicated member of the Belgrade Madrigalists.
Nemeček’s grandfather, a co-founder of the Music Academy and the Belgrade Philharmonic, left an indelible mark on Serbia’s cultural landscape, serving as both a lecturer and a performer at the Belgrade Opera.
In the present day, the family’s artistic legacy takes on a contemporary form through Nemeček’s son, Jan. Adopting a hands-off approach, Nemecek allowed Jan to explore his creative path. Jan’s journey led him from the world of computers to music, where he showcased his talent in composing for television and delving into techno music.
